Top 10 Asian Noodles Producers in the United States
Asian noodles have become increasingly popular in the United States, with a variety of flavors and styles to choose from. This report will highlight the top 10 Asian noodles producers in the country, providing insights into their financial performance, market share, and industry trends.
1. Nissin Foods Holdings Co., Ltd.
Nissin Foods Holdings Co., Ltd. is a Japanese company that has a strong presence in the United States market with its popular brands like Top Ramen and Cup Noodles. The company has seen steady growth in its revenue and market share over the years, making it one of the top Asian noodles producers in the country.
2. Nongshim Co., Ltd.
Nongshim Co., Ltd. is a South Korean company known for its instant noodles brand Shin Ramyun. The company has a significant market share in the United States and has been expanding its product offerings to cater to the diverse consumer preferences in the country.
3. Ajinomoto Co., Inc.
Ajinomoto Co., Inc. is a Japanese company that produces a variety of food products, including Asian noodles. The company has a strong presence in the United States market with its brand Ajinomoto Yakisoba and has been focusing on innovation and product development to stay competitive in the industry.
4. Ottogi Co., Ltd.
Ottogi Co., Ltd. is a South Korean company that has gained popularity in the United States with its instant noodles brand Jin Ramen. The company has been investing in marketing and advertising to increase brand awareness and capture a larger market share in the country.
5. Toyo Suisan Kaisha, Ltd.
Toyo Suisan Kaisha, Ltd. is a Japanese company that produces a wide range of food products, including instant noodles under the brand Maruchan. The company has a strong distribution network in the United States and has been focused on expanding its product portfolio to meet the growing demand for Asian noodles.
6. Myojo Foods Co., Ltd.
Myojo Foods Co., Ltd. is a Japanese company that specializes in producing instant noodles under the brand Myojo Chukazanmai. The company has a loyal customer base in the United States and has been introducing new flavors and varieties to cater to changing consumer preferences.
7. Mamee-Double Decker (M) Sdn Bhd
Mamee-Double Decker (M) Sdn Bhd is a Malaysian company that has a presence in the United States market with its instant noodles brand Mamee. The company has been focusing on product quality and affordability to attract a larger customer base in the country.
8. KOKA Pte Ltd
KOKA Pte Ltd is a Singaporean company that produces a variety of instant noodles under the brand KOKA. The company has been expanding its distribution channels in the United States and has been gaining popularity among consumers for its authentic Asian flavors.
9. Vifon
Vifon is a Vietnamese company that produces instant noodles under the brand Vifon. The company has been increasing its market share in the United States by offering a wide range of flavors and packaging options to cater to different consumer preferences.
10. JML Instant Noodle Manufacturing Co., Ltd.
JML Instant Noodle Manufacturing Co., Ltd. is a Chinese company that has been expanding its presence in the United States market with its instant noodles brand JML. The company has been focusing on product innovation and quality to differentiate itself from competitors and attract more customers.
In conclusion, the Asian noodles market in the United States is highly competitive, with these top 10 producers leading the way in terms of market share and innovation. As consumer demand for convenient and flavorful food options continues to grow, these companies are likely to see continued success in the market.
